Sinopsi
The book of Sent Soví is the oldest surviving cookbook written in the Catalan language. It stands, therefore, at the very beginning of the country's culinary tradition, and within its pages can already be found certain defining features that have endured to the present day. Its influence can be traced throughout other medieval cookbooks and even in later culinary works. This status as an inaugural text, partly the result of historical circumstance, does not contradict the fact that it is also a synthesis of the cuisine of its time—specifically, the haute cuisine associated with the nobility and the wealthy classes.
This edition includes an English translation of the original Catalan text, with the aim of broadening the reach of this work and bringing the rich heritage of medieval Catalan cuisine to a wider international audience. To facilitate access to the text, the medieval version is presented alongside an adaptation into modern English.
This volume marks the beginning of the Set Portes Collection of Historical Catalan Cookbooks, which offers a comprehensive journey from the earliest recipe collections to those of the second half of the twentieth century, highlighting the evolution, transformations, and continuities of Catalan cuisine.
